ActiveCampaign and phone.systems™ Integration
Connecting phone.systems™ with ActiveCampaign CRM allows you to manage customer calls and synchronize contact data. The integration includes the following features:
Sync contacts automatically: Keep contacts updated between phone.systems™ and ActiveCampaign CRM.
Call journaling: Calls can be logged in ActiveCampaign for tracking and reference.
Create new contacts automatically: When an unknown number calls, a new contact can be created in ActiveCampaign automatically.
Upload AI call insights results: AI-generated call analytics can be added to call logs.
Note
Call journaling and AI call insights are available only on the ActiveCampaign Enterprise plan.

Step 7: Enable phone-only contacts in ActiveCampaign
ActiveCampaign requires an email address by default when creating new contacts. To allow phone.systems™ to create and synchronize contacts using only a phone number, phone-only contacts must be enabled in the ActiveCampaign advanced settings.
This allows the integration to automatically create or update contacts based on calls and other phone activity.
Important
Enabling phone-only contacts is a permanent change and cannot be undone. Learn more about phone-only contacts .
Go to the ActiveCampaign user interface and open Settings.
Navigate to Advanced Settings and find the Phone-only contacts section.
Enable the Phone-only contacts toggle.
Click Save Settings.

Associate users for ActiveCampaign
After the ActiveCampaign integration is successfully connected, you can associate ActiveCampaign users with their corresponding phone.systems™ users.
User association enables call journaling by ensuring that inbound and outbound calls are logged on the correct contacts in ActiveCampaign. Only calls handled by associated users are recorded. Calls handled by users who are not associated are not journaled.
Note
Call journaling for ActiveCampaign is available only on the ActiveCampaign Enterprise plan.
Go to phone.systems™ Settings, then open CRM Integrations.
Under Active Integrations at the top of the page, you will see ActiveCampaign marked as Connected.
Click Associate users.
Fig. 8. Associate users button for ActiveCampaign integration
After clicking Associate users, a dialog opens where you can link ActiveCampaign users with corresponding phone.systems™ users.
Match each ActiveCampaign user with the appropriate phone.systems™ user.
Click Save to apply the changes.

Call journaling
Important
Call journaling is available only on the ActiveCampaign Enterprise plan.
Each phone number must be configured individually for call journaling.
Auto Contact Creation and Other Settings apply only for numbers with enabled call journaling.
Call journaling automatically logs inbound and outbound calls as activities on related contacts in ActiveCampaign.
Enable call journaling for each required number in the phone numbers menu.
Auto contact creation
This feature automatically creates a new contact when a call is handled from a number that does not match an existing contact.
Setting |
Description |
|---|---|
Inbound calls |
Create a contact for inbound calls from unknown numbers. |
Outbound calls |
Create a contact for outbound calls to unknown numbers. |
Important
ActiveCampaign does not notify phone.systems™ when a contact is deleted.
Contacts that still exist in ActiveCampaign cannot be deleted from phone.systems™. To remove a contact from phone.systems™, delete it in ActiveCampaign first.
